Output c0e988bd0cf01978279fc6708fe50960d85566eb80828f55060729bd66ed0b51:17

value
11523890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c88dda32c4d970d76274a71074d2e25f49b47db OP_EQUAL
address
MGLSMgLfPrrGLGTGi8yMfZUzWdw1k1uyEa
transaction
c0e988bd0cf01978279fc6708fe50960d85566eb80828f55060729bd66ed0b51
spent
true